114 billion riyals .. The increase in the contribution of the agricultural sector to the gross product

The Deputy Minister of Environment, Water and Agriculture, Eng. Mansour Al -Mushaiti, confirmed that a success in reaching (93%) of its indicators achieved its annual targets, including a contribution to the gross domestic product by more than (6%) during the past eight years, to reach by the end of 2024 AD to (114) billion riyals.
This came during a speech in (Hail Investment Forum 2025), which was held today in the city of Hail, in the presence and patronage of His Royal Highness Prince Abdulaziz bin Saad Al Saud, Governor of the Hail region, and a number of officials, investors, and economic experts; To review and discuss specific investment opportunities in the Hail region.
The engineer explained that the Hail region, with its elements and natural resources; It is a unique incubator for investment, especially in the agricultural field.
He pointed out that continuous government support was reflected positively on sustainable agricultural development in the region; Where the total financing of the Agricultural Development Fund in the Hail region exceeded (7) billion riyals, which contributed to the high rate of its contribution to the Kingdom’s gross domestic product to the Kingdom to more than (10%).

Production of clotted salmon

The deputy minister indicated that the Hail region witnessed the inauguration of the first and largest project of its kind in the Middle East to produce cloned salmon, which will contribute to reducing the Kingdom’s imports of these fish by (50%), in addition to achieving total sales of more than (5) billion riyals, during the next ten years.
He revealed the signing of the largest investment for the production of red meat in one location, in Hail, in order to enhance the self -sufficiency of red meat in the Kingdom, which reached (61%) by the end of 2024 AD, noting that the Hail region today embraces one of the largest poultry production projects, with its production capacity exceeding (130) thousand tons annually, and the project recently witnessed an expansion of more than (4.5) billion riyals. And total exceeding (11) billion riyals; To become the largest project in poultry production locally and regional.
In addition, Eng. Al -Mushaiti pointed out that the sustainable agricultural rural development program “Saudi countryside” contributed to the development of the local economy, increased the income of small farmers, and improving their livelihood; Where the program provided about 800 million riyals to small farmers in the Hail region.

Agricultural production growth

Al -Mushaiti added that the program started implementing (3) projects in the region with a value exceeding (40) million riyals; Which will contribute to the growth of agricultural production in the region and the development of marketing services for agricultural products.
He noted the importance of developing infrastructure to enhance investment; Where the foundation stone was recently laid to implement (14) water and environmental projects in the Hail region, at a total cost exceeding (1.2) billion riyals, and the foundation stone was also laid for (7) projects to develop vegetation, with a value exceeding (116) million riyals, within the framework of the Saudi Green Initiative efforts, to develop vegetation and support the afforestation.
He pointed to the most promising investment opportunities currently in the Hail region, including, “Burj Al -Jawhara”, which will contribute to promoting water and operational sustainability, as it provides a storage of about (13) thousand m3 of water, in addition to the investment of the tower facilities and the surrounding area.
He explained that the ministry is currently working on launching more than (40) investment sites in Hail, among them, Al -Shannan Park and Al -Naya Park, in addition to agricultural nurseries and marketing services centers.
